Poetry - Life


The life in the breath slowly fades
It gets smaller and weaker with each exhale
The pain of each inhale becomes unbearably painful

The remaining thumps of the heart
They are slowing down
Only a brief few remain

A shell, that’s all that is left
That inner light that shone so bright...
Gone, it’s faded away, leaving just the shell

But there is so much attachment to the shell
The pains of watching the light fade
Unbearable, the over whelming suffocation of grief

The light, that traitor light
It just left, even though it promised to stay

It lied, knew it was a lie but that small part
Buried down deep inside so wanted to believe the lie
Wanted the light to stay forever

But the light left and the shell crumbled
Leaving the hope behind, stumbling blindly into the dark

Exposed and all alone
Screaming in the godless pain of being ripped apart

Shattered because the light was the foundation
The foundation that grew the hope
Made the hope was it became

It will survive without the light
But it will never be the same

There is a darkness that is now buried deep within the core of the hope
A darkness that has changed hope on such a level that its base is cracked

The crack went right though what made hope so strong
It is just enough to keep hope from being steady and stable
